By kkkman22
Unified AI coding workflow framework — single /forge slash command with 32 internal subcommands, TDD, spec-driven planning, and automated review.
架构视角评估者。在 /forge decide 的 Agent Team 中提供架构视角,评估技术选型合理性、架构风险、扩展性和兼容性。
对抗性审查角色。专门挑战其他 Agent 的计划和决策,找出漏洞、盲点和未考虑的风险。
根因分析与构建错误修复专家。追踪 bug 到根本原因,用最小改动修复,不做多余的重构。
设计视角评估者(条件触发)。仅当任务涉及 UI 变更时动态加入 /forge decide 的 Agent Team,评估可用性、可访问性和一致性。
只读代码库搜索专家。快速扫描项目结构、定位文件和代码模式、梳理依赖关系,为 plan 和 build 阶段提供准确的代码库上下文。
Executes bash commands
Hook triggers when Bash tool is used
Modifies files
Hook triggers on file write and edit operations
Uses power tools
Own this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imOwn this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imBased on adoption, maintenance, documentation, and repository signals. Not a security audit or endorsement.
This plugin requires configuration values that are prompted when the plugin is enabled. Sensitive values are stored in your system keychain.
safety_levelSafety strictness (1=strictest)
${user_config.safety_level}max_parallel_agentsMax concurrent subagents (1-10, default 6)
${user_config.max_parallel_agents}Uses Bash, Write, or Edit tools
Uses Bash, Write, or Edit tools
统一
/forge入口 + 21 个内部子命令覆盖完整开发生命周期,三维路由自动匹配复杂度,统一状态系统跨会话感知。前置条件:Claude Code ≥ 2.1.153 | 安装指南 完整兼容性矩阵和降级策略见 docs/claude-code-compatibility.md
.forge/,跨命令状态感知和会话恢复# 1. 安装(Plugin 方式,推荐)
claude plugin marketplace add https://github.com/kkkman22/Forge
claude plugin install forge
# 2. 初始化项目(仅首次)
/forge init
# 3. 验证安装
/forge status
# 4. 第一次使用
/forge 修复 README 中的拼写错误
完整快速入门指南(含 3 种安装方式、故障排除、端到端示例)→ docs/quick-start.md
| 文档 | 路径 | 适用场景 |
|---|---|---|
| 快速入门 | docs/quick-start.md | 首次接触,5 分钟上手 |
| 初次接触者引导 | docs/onboarding-beginner.md | 了解基本概念和常用命令 |
| 日常开发者引导 | docs/onboarding-daily.md | 掌握标准工作流各阶段 |
| 高级用户引导 | docs/onboarding-advanced.md | 深入全量路径、知识系统、贡献指南 |
| 命令速查 | docs/reference-commands.md | 查看全部 21 个命令和路由详解 |
| 安全参考 | docs/reference-security.md | 了解安全机制分层和审计 |
| 架构参考 | docs/reference-architecture.md | 深入了解 .forge/ 目录结构和状态保护 |
| 高级功能参考 | docs/reference-advanced.md | Forge Loop、cmux、Domain Pack、Token 效率 |
| 兼容性参考 | docs/claude-code-compatibility.md | Claude Code 版本兼容性和降级策略 |
| 维度 | /forge accept | /forge verify | /forge ship |
|---|---|---|---|
| 触发时机 | Spec 验收场景执行 | 证据化三态验证收尾 | 最终交付前合规/合并/release |
| 主要责任 | 运行场景脚本并记录验收结果 | 汇总所有证据、产出三态结论 | 综合前置门禁、执行合并/tag |
| 典型输出 | .forge/acceptance/<scenario>.md | .forge/findings/<topic>/verify-this/ | PR merge + tag + CHANGELOG |
| 下游接续 | → /forge verify 或 /forge ship --with-acceptance | → /forge ship | Release 完成 |
claude plugin marketplace add https://github.com/kkkman22/Forge
claude plugin install forge
所有新用户推荐此方式。无需 git 或 Node.js。
git clone https://github.com/kkkman22/Forge.git ~/.claude/skills/forge
包含完整功能:
/forge命令 + Forge Loop 带工程纪律的自主执行引擎。额外需要npm install && npx tsc。
git clone https://github.com/kkkman22/Forge.git /tmp/forge
bash /tmp/forge/scripts/build-dist.sh
bash /tmp/forge/scripts/install-dist.sh
只含
/forge命令,不含 Forge Loop。适合团队统一部署。
Plugin 安装后,以下命令可直接在终端使用:
| 命令 | 说明 |
|---|---|
forge-doctor | 项目健康检查(.forge/ 结构、配置、hooks) |
forge-status | 显示当前任务状态(tier/phase/progress) |
forge-restate | 触发 restatement checkpoint(可选 --check 工具) |
所有命令支持 --help。
Forge plugin 自带 forge-context first-party MCP server,为 /forge review 提供智能 diff 截断和上下文优化。
实测效果:
/forge review19 文件变更场景 token 消耗从 700K+ 降至 <200K。
| 命令 | 说明 | 路径 |
|---|---|---|
/forge | 入口,三维路由分析任务 | 所有 |
/forge plan | 将 Spec 拆解为原子任务 | 标准、全量 |
/forge build | 按计划 TDD 实现代码 | 所有 |
/forge review | 三层独立评审 | 所有 |
/forge test | 运行完整验证套件 | 标准、全量 |
/forge ship | 门禁检查 + 交付 | 标准、全量 |
/forge decide | 四视角前置决策 | 全量 |
/forge learn | 五维度经验沉淀 | 全量 |
/forge spec | 将需求固化为可锁定规格 | 全量 |
/forge verify | 证据化三态验证 | 所有 |
/forge accept | 场景验收执行 | 所有 |
/forge debug | 四阶段结构化根因分析 | 所有 |
/forge status | 查看当前任务状态 | 所有 |
/forge resume | 会话恢复 | 所有 |
/forge grill | 苏格拉底式需求澄清 | 所有 |
/forge storm | 头脑风暴 | 所有 |
/forge recap | 会话摘要与上下文回顾 | 所有 |
/forge loop | 带工程纪律的自主循环 | 所有 |
完整子命令速查表和三维路由详解 → docs/reference-commands.md
| 档位 | 判定条件 | 命令序列 |
|---|---|---|
| 轻量路径 | 影响 ≤1 文件,改动 ≤20 行 | build → review |
| 标准路径 | 需求明确或有现成 Spec | plan → build → review → test → ship |
| 全量路径 | 新服务/数据库/认证变更或需求模糊 | decide → spec → plan → build → review → test → ship → learn |
npx claudepluginhub kkkman22/forge --plugin forgeHarness-native ECC operator layer - 67 agents, 271 skills, 92 legacy command shims, reusable hooks, rules, selective install profiles, and production-ready workflows for Claude Code, Codex, OpenCode, Cursor, and related agent harnesses
Comprehensive skill pack with 66 specialized skills for full-stack developers: 12 language experts (Python, TypeScript, Go, Rust, C++, Swift, Kotlin, C#, PHP, Java, SQL, JavaScript), 10 backend frameworks, 6 frontend/mobile, plus infrastructure, DevOps, security, and testing. Features progressive disclosure architecture for 50% faster loading.
Access thousands of AI prompts and skills directly in your AI coding assistant. Search prompts, discover skills, save your own, and improve prompts with AI.
Upstash Context7 MCP server for up-to-date documentation lookup. Pull version-specific documentation and code examples directly from source repositories into your LLM context.
Complete developer toolkit for Claude Code
Core skills library for Claude Code: TDD, debugging, collaboration patterns, and proven techniques